
A musical journey representing cultures from all over the globe each week, culminating in the Accordion Festival. Curated by Ariana Hellerman.
Accordions Around the World is a four-week series that brings dozens of accordionists, as well as bandoneón, bayan, concertina, and harmonium-players of different musical genres, to perform at Bryant Park. Audiences have a chance to experience the range of this often-overlooked instrument in an intimate performance setting. Wander the park to explore different musical stylings or set up a picnic in one location and experience different artists as they rotate around the park.
Accordions Around the World performances take place on Wednesdays from July 24 – August 14, 2019 from 5:30pm – 7:30pm. On Friday, August 16 at 5pm, the series culminates with the Accordion Festival, a five-hour celebration showcasing four accordion-led bands playing music from a range of different cultures. This year’s festival includes the winner of Colombia’s prestigious Festival de Vallenato, el Rey Vallenato Beto Jamaica, and more to be announced this summer.

About Bryant Park Corporation:
Bryant Park Corporation (BPC), a private not-for-profit company, was founded in 1980 to renovate, finance and operate Bryant Park in New York City. BPC is funded by income from events, concessions and corporate sponsors, as well as an assessment on neighboring properties, and does not accept government or philanthropic monies.
In addition to providing security, sanitation, and horticultural services, BPC offers restaurants, food kiosks, world-class restrooms, and a wide range of free events throughout the year. The Midtown Manhattan park is visited by more than 12 million people each year and is one of the busiest public spaces in the world. Location and Directions:
Bryant Park is situated behind the New York Public Library in midtown Manhattan, between 40th and 42nd Streets & Fifth and Sixth Avenues. Take the B, D, F, or M train to 42nd Street/Bryant Park; or, take the 7 train to 5th Avenue.
